    I recently heard Nancy had died in the last week. I wanted to post to this
    echo to record how I will miss her presence. She was a chatty colorful person in many echomail areas and had clearly been active for years.

    I think the wider BBS community looses a special someone with her passing.

    Even though I was not overly active in Fido echos I recognize the real contribution to the social discourse that she made.

    RIP Nancy. You will be missed.
